Output 51327e4defc63539d12decff3e4867eb06e987fcd07b06688391e1b7bf470603:1

value
23977054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c29bbb02e94b0ffa82228a26797abdc527fa3f2 OP_EQUALVERIFY OP_CHECKSIG
address
127K6yQfnbe7RGimmfLA8BDp8DDGU8P27Y
transaction
51327e4defc63539d12decff3e4867eb06e987fcd07b06688391e1b7bf470603
spent
true